Punjab Member of Parliament Dr. Balbir Singh Seechewal inaugurated a new cricket academy in Jalandhar on Sunday, using the occasion to deliver a strong message on environmental conservation. The MP, known for his environmental activism, stated that polluting nature goes against the core teachings of Sikhism.
Academy Inauguration and Message
Speaking at the event, Seechewal said, "Sikhism teaches us to respect and protect nature. Polluting our environment is a sin against the principles of our faith." He urged the youth to not only excel in sports but also become ambassadors of environmental protection.
Focus on Sikh Teachings
The MP highlighted that Guru Nanak Dev Ji's philosophy emphasizes the sanctity of nature. "We must preserve our rivers, air, and soil for future generations. Our actions today determine the world we leave behind," he added.
The cricket academy aims to provide training to young talent in the region. Seechewal expressed hope that the academy would produce players who represent the nation while upholding ethical values.
Local residents and cricket enthusiasts welcomed the initiative, praising the MP's dual focus on sports and environmental awareness. The academy is expected to nurture budding cricketers and promote a culture of ecological responsibility.
